Why It Matters

What New Windows Mean for Your Home

Modern A-rated windows and doors can make a real difference to how your home feels day to day, how much your energy bills cost, and how much your property is worth. Qualifying for funding means you pay less for improvements that make a real difference to North East families.

Warmer Home

Modern windows reduce heat loss, keeping your home warmer for longer without your boiler working overtime.

Lower Energy Bills

Less heat escaping means less energy needed. Families report noticeable drops in heating costs after upgrading.

Reduced Noise

Double glazing significantly reduces outside noise, creating a quieter, more comfortable home environment.

Added Property Value

New windows boost kerb appeal and market value - a smart long-term investment in your home.

Better Security

Modern windows use multi-point locking systems, offering far better security than older, single-lock alternatives.

Improved EPC Rating

Upgrading to A-rated windows can improve your Energy Performance Certificate rating and reduce your carbon footprint.
